The Associate Patient Care Coordinator (Primary Care/Internal Medicine) is responsible to the Center Administrator and provides appointment scheduling, patient registration, cashiering, answers incoming calls and performs other related clerical functions. This primary role provides front office support functions. Schedule: Monday-Friday, 8-hour shift between the hours of 7:30am-5pm EST. Schedule to be determined by manager upon hire. Location : 307 W. Main St. Kent, OH. Training and coverage may be required at Tallmadge location (116 East Ave, Ste 3, Tallmadge, OH 44278), depending on business need.

Primary Responsibilities

Taking messages for providers, handling forms: FMLA/Disability/BMV Collecting copays and patient balances that are due at time of check in Requesting records and retrieving records from offices/hospitals Prepping charts, scanning documents Verifies patient insurance coverage and eligibility utilizing computer-based patient registration / scheduling system Documents appropriate information in patient's charts using an electronic medical records system Completes and maintains physician's schedules, coordinating patient visits and medical procedures Ensure patient insurance information through EMR system What are the reasons to consider working for UnitedHealth Group?
